Myth #3: PSC Certification is Always Valid

Another common belief is that once you get your PSC Certification, it lasts forever. But that’s not the case! ⚠️

Most certifications have an expiration date. You might need to renew it every few years by completing professional development courses. It’s essential to keep your skills up-to-date. Education evolves, so staying current helps everyone.

Myth #4: It Guarantees a Job

Some people think that simply getting certified means a guaranteed job. I wish it worked that way! But reality check: getting certified doesn’t automatically land you a teaching position.

While it definitely boosts your chances, you still need to ace the interviews and showcase your passion for teaching or administration. Think of it as a stepping stone rather than a golden ticket.
